One of the most popular Christmas markets in Europe can be found in the historic city of Cologne, Germany. The Cologne Christmas Market, or “Weihnachtsmarkt,” is spread out across several locations in the city, with the largest market located in front of the famous Cologne Cathedral. Here, visitors can browse through an array of artisanal crafts, seasonal gifts, and delicious food and drink. The scent of freshly baked gingerbread and sizzling sausages wafts through the air, enticing visitors to sample traditional German treats like stollen and glühwein.
For those looking to experience a truly magical Christmas market, a visit to Strasbourg in France is a must. Christkindelsmärik, the oldest Christmas market in France, takes place in the heart of Strasbourg’s historic city center. The streets are adorned with hundreds of twinkling lights and festive decorations, creating a truly enchanting atmosphere. Visitors can browse through the market stalls selling handcrafted ornaments, wooden toys, and regional delicacies like bredele, a traditional Alsatian Christmas cookie. The highlight of the market is the Great Christmas Tree, towering over the market square and illuminated by thousands of twinkling lights.

For a truly unique Christmas market experience, a visit to the medieval town of Tallinn, Estonia is a must. The Tallinn Christmas Market takes place in the historic Old Town, which is a UNESCO World Heritage site. The market stalls line the cobbled streets and squares, offering a glimpse into the town’s rich history and culture. Visitors can shop for handmade crafts, sample traditional Estonian cuisine, and enjoy the festive entertainment, including choir performances and folk dances. The highlight of the market is the majestic Christmas tree in the Town Hall Square, which is lit up in a dazzling display of lights and decorations.
